Ayman Kharaba is a scholar working on Molecular Medicine, Endocrinology and Infectious Diseases. According to data from OpenAlex, Ayman Kharaba has authored 10 papers receiving a total of 85 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Molecular Medicine, 4 papers in Endocrinology and 3 papers in Infectious Diseases. Recurrent topics in Ayman Kharaba's work include Antibiotic Resistance in Bacteria (5 papers), Vibrio bacteria research studies (4 papers) and Urinary Tract Infections Management (2 papers). Ayman Kharaba is often cited by papers focused on Antibiotic Resistance in Bacteria (5 papers), Vibrio bacteria research studies (4 papers) and Urinary Tract Infections Management (2 papers). Ayman Kharaba collaborates with scholars based in Saudi Arabia, Egypt and Bahrain. Ayman Kharaba's co-authors include Hamdan Al‐Jahdali, Fahad Al-Hameed, Shadi A. Zakai, Alyaa Elhazmi, Yaseen M. Arabi, Adnan Alghamdi, Yasser Mandourah, Mohammed W. Al-Rabia, Mohammed A. Hussein and Hani Lababidi and has published in prestigious journals such as SHILAP Revista de lepidopterología, Journal of Critical Care and Journal of Infection and Public Health.
